Improvements and suggestion for italian typing.
Posted: Thu Jan 27, 2011 9:34 am
Hello, I am an italian user, I've been using SKP for a couple of months now and i came here to provide some feedback to improve SKP behaviour with the italian language.
Stated that i use 99% of times the T9 layout, here are my suggestions:
1- First of all, i totally agree with the necessity to fix the apostrophe issue. As stated before, the perfect behaviour of SKP should be, whenever a ' is typed, to consider the following typing as a separate word to be searched on the dict. In that way SK would not look in the dictionary for "l'word" wich 99% of the times is not there, but just for the "l'word" wich will hopefully be there! This would be a huge improvement as italian language makes a huge use of "elision" with many different words like articles, prepositions, etc.
2a- Single tapping behaviour: italian language makes a very large use of these single vowels: e, i, o. I believe that typing experience would be much more comfortable if tapping "6" would give me "o" as a first choice instead of "m" (wich is never used as a single letter in italian). Same exact thing for "4" giving me "i" instead of "g" and 3 giving me "e" instead of "d".
"E" is the italian conjunction (like english "and"); "i" is an article, (like english "the") and "o" stands for "or". This quick explanation just to let you imagine how many times italians use these single letters, and how much better it would be to have these vowels instead of the consonants when tapping the relative keys.
2b- Another thing I would like to suggest on the single tap of the numeric pad is to give a wider variety of predictions. I'll go straight to the point:
Tapping "2" should give me these predictions: a, b, c, à, 2
Tapping "3" should give me: e, d, f, è, é, 3
Tapping "4" should give me: i, g, h, ì, 4
Tapping "5" should give me: l, j, k, 5
Tapping "6" should give me: o, m, n, ò, 6
Tapping "7" should give me: p, q, r, s, 7
Tapping "8" should give me: t, u, v, ù, 8
Tapping "9" should give me: w, x, y, z, 9
That way it would be more comfortable to insert numbers and accented vowels, when needed.
I understand that this could be a lot of work to do, and I also understand that some of these features I've requested are useful/wanted only for italian language, so I don't know if you could just teach SK to behave differently when the italian dict is selected, or if it would be more convenient for you to add an "italian mode" check box to the settings in order to implement these features.
I also would like to know from others italian users what they think about the single tapping feature request.
Thank you for your attention, and thank you for the great work you are doing with SKP.
Stated that i use 99% of times the T9 layout, here are my suggestions:
1- First of all, i totally agree with the necessity to fix the apostrophe issue. As stated before, the perfect behaviour of SKP should be, whenever a ' is typed, to consider the following typing as a separate word to be searched on the dict. In that way SK would not look in the dictionary for "l'word" wich 99% of the times is not there, but just for the "l'word" wich will hopefully be there! This would be a huge improvement as italian language makes a huge use of "elision" with many different words like articles, prepositions, etc.
2a- Single tapping behaviour: italian language makes a very large use of these single vowels: e, i, o. I believe that typing experience would be much more comfortable if tapping "6" would give me "o" as a first choice instead of "m" (wich is never used as a single letter in italian). Same exact thing for "4" giving me "i" instead of "g" and 3 giving me "e" instead of "d".
"E" is the italian conjunction (like english "and"); "i" is an article, (like english "the") and "o" stands for "or". This quick explanation just to let you imagine how many times italians use these single letters, and how much better it would be to have these vowels instead of the consonants when tapping the relative keys.
2b- Another thing I would like to suggest on the single tap of the numeric pad is to give a wider variety of predictions. I'll go straight to the point:
Tapping "2" should give me these predictions: a, b, c, à, 2
Tapping "3" should give me: e, d, f, è, é, 3
Tapping "4" should give me: i, g, h, ì, 4
Tapping "5" should give me: l, j, k, 5
Tapping "6" should give me: o, m, n, ò, 6
Tapping "7" should give me: p, q, r, s, 7
Tapping "8" should give me: t, u, v, ù, 8
Tapping "9" should give me: w, x, y, z, 9
That way it would be more comfortable to insert numbers and accented vowels, when needed.
I understand that this could be a lot of work to do, and I also understand that some of these features I've requested are useful/wanted only for italian language, so I don't know if you could just teach SK to behave differently when the italian dict is selected, or if it would be more convenient for you to add an "italian mode" check box to the settings in order to implement these features.
I also would like to know from others italian users what they think about the single tapping feature request.
Thank you for your attention, and thank you for the great work you are doing with SKP.